On Sat, 15 Jun 2002, Ollie Acheson wrote:

> Shortly after I upgraded to 2.30, I got the following spam which, as
> you can see, received a negative score. I don't understand why, since
> neither the from nor the to are in my whitelist.
> 
> Is this a bug?

It's not strictly a bug, it's just the way the scoring algorithm computed
new scores this time.

> > X-Spam-Status: No, hits=-2.1 required=5.0
> >     tests=X_NOT_PRESENT,NO_REAL_NAME,PLING_PLING,PLING
> >     version=2.30

Two of the rule score changes since 2.21:

score: NO_REAL_NAME 0.632 -> -1.068
score: X_NOT_PRESENT 0.500 -> -1.920

A message that short probably wouldn't have scored above 5.0 anyway, but 
those two rules appear not to be very useful.
